How to Interpret Crawl Intelligence
When reviewing crawl activity, focus on patterns rather than isolated requests.
Ask questions such as:
Are AI systems consistently discovering important content?
Important pages should be accessible and revisited over time.
Consistent crawl activity generally indicates ongoing AI interaction with those resources.
Is crawl activity expanding?
Increasing crawl coverage may indicate that AI systems are discovering additional website content.
Understanding which areas are receiving increased attention helps guide future optimization.
Are important resources being missed?
Pages that are strategically important but receive limited AI crawler activity may warrant additional investigation.
Review website accessibility, internal linking, and AI access configuration where appropriate.
Are crawl patterns changing?
Changes in crawl frequency or coverage may reflect:
- Website updates.
- AI ecosystem changes.
- Configuration changes.
- Content expansion.
Historical observation provides important context for interpreting these patterns.
Common Crawl Patterns
Organizations commonly observe one or more of the following patterns.
Stable Crawl Activity
AI systems consistently revisit important website content.
This often indicates stable long-term accessibility.
Expanding Discovery
AI systems begin discovering additional website sections or resources.
This may reflect growing website coverage or improved accessibility.
Uneven Crawl Distribution
Certain website areas receive substantially more AI crawler activity than others.
Organizations should evaluate whether this distribution aligns with business priorities.
Reduced Crawl Activity
Significant reductions in crawl activity may warrant further investigation.
Review recent website changes, access configuration, and monitoring history before drawing conclusions.
